I have just received a call from John to say he came down to the railway on Sunday, he was on his own but there is always something to do in the workshop so John set about stripping years of paint from some of the carriage terminal covers which we had removed the previous week.
These particular covers were made from cast iron instead of the usual softer material which made it difficult to remove the layers of paint, John eventually gave up and decided to take them home and to use nitromors to shift the paint.
The phone in the workshop rang and John was asked if he would change a D type bulbs in the gents toilets and check the bulbs in the ladies toilets at Ramsbottom Station.
The D type bulb in the Gents toilet was changed for the spare kept in the Station.
In the Ladies one of the D type bulbs was flashing this one will be replaced next week.
Whilst John was at Ramsbottom he was asked if he would have a look at the automatic water flusher in the Gents urinals, this is a small electronic box containing a timer and a valve. John established the problem was a blown fuse, a new one will be sourced and fitted.
John then returned to the workshop to pick up the components he was going to work on at home and called it a day.
